Rochester is located in western New York, it is a deepwater port on the Genesee River and Lake Ontario. The city includes land on both sides of the Genesee River, which links the downtown area with Lake Ontario. Three waterfalls occur along the river’s course through the city: the Upper, Middle, and Lower falls. The core of Rochester’s economy is high-technology manufacturing and research. A 2006 real estate survey has estimated the population of Rochester, New York at 208,123.

More about Rochester, New York

The first development came in 1789 when Ebenezer Allen erected a flour mill at falls on the Genesee. The enterprise failed, and in 1803 the land was purchased by Nathaniel Rochester and two associates. Rochester laid out the community in 1811 and named it for himself; permanent settlement began in 1812. Growth was spurred by the completion in 1825 of the Erie Canal, and Rochester was incorporated as a city in 1834. It was a great flour-milling city until that industry moved west in the 1870s. The waterfalls on the river provided the mills with power and the Erie Canal provided transportation. From the 1850s Rochester was a horticultural center, noted for many large nurseries and beautiful parks. During the mid-19th century the city was a focus of political crusading, especially for abolition and women’s rights.

The manufacturing industries that now form the basis of the city’s economy were established during the second half of the 19th and early 20th centuries. Eastman began marketing his cameras in 1888; John Jacob Bausch and Henry Lomb began with an optical shop that grew into the giant Bausch & Lomb Incorporated and the Haloid Company, later to become the Xerox Corporation, started in a loft above a shoe factory in 1906.

Rochester is a processing and distributing point for an extensive fruit-growing region. The city is noted as the home of the photographic-equipment manufacturer Eastman Kodak founded by inventor George Eastman in 1880. The region’s largest manufacturing employers make imaging products such as photographic film and copiers, document-processing products, emission-control components and electrical parts for automobiles, eyewear, and telecommunication products. The city is a noted center for laser research. Other important employers include companies providing payroll services, computer training, and financial services.
